For the first time in his NFL career, Tom Brady is prepared to discuss a future with teams beyond the New England Patriots, sources said, and for the first time since he took over as a starter nearly two decades ago, the Patriots are unsure of who will be under center in 2020.
It would be extremely surprising if Brady were to agree to any new pact with the Patriots prior to the start of free agency in March, I'm told, and while his process could still result in a return to New England it is far from certain at this point. Brady intends to take a methodical approach to his first foray into free agency, as, at age 42, this will be the final contract of his playing career.
Brady and his team will weigh all options available to determine which opportunity provides the best chance to continue competing for the Lombardi Trophy and to see what other organizations think of him at this late stage in his career. As one source put it, Brady will do his due diligence to assess all realistic possibilities, with it only "human nature" to explore this chance to embrace his free-agent status for the first time in his career.

NBC Sports Boston's Gary Tanguay reported late Thursday that the legendary quarterback and his family are "planning to leave the area." Citing an anonymous source, Tanguay suggested the 42-year-old Brady is "embarrassed" by his compensation in contrast to contracts of other NFL quarterbacks and figures to depart the Patriots in March.
The priority for Brady and his family, Tanguay said, "is to let the kids finish school this year, and then they're gone."
NBC Sports Boston's Tom Curran recently disputed a November report that Brady had moved into a new home in Greenwich, Connecticut, but WEEI's Greg Hill has also indicated that Brady's family suite at Gillette Stadium has been thoroughly cleaned out. The Bradys' current home, in Brookline, Massachusetts, remains for sale, per NBC Sports.
